hi all just a bit of advice i have a school to clean very soon i have a 500 x-line system i need another 100 metre hose reel attached to the 1st hose reel my question is do you think it have enough power to pump water to the extra hose reel ?? i do have a back bag but it will take too long to keep topping up with water as its a long walk not getting any younger loool

Yes no problem we regularly do this on some large commercial jobs , just up the flow rate on the controller , and you will be fine , pump will get a bit hotter than normal  but we haven’t had any issues .
